Job Summary

We are looking for a Senior Microsoft Dynamics 365 CRM Consultant to design, implement, and optimize CRM solutions that enhance customer engagement and business processes. The ideal candidate will have deep expertise in Microsoft Dynamics 365 Customer Engagement (CE), strong problem-solving skills, and the ability to work with cross-functional teams.

Key Responsibilities

  • ⁠ ⁠Lead the design and development of Microsoft Dynamics 365 CRM solutions to meet business needs.
  • ⁠ ⁠Configure and customize Dynamics 365 modules (Sales, Customer Service, Marketing, Field Service).
  • ⁠ ⁠Develop and optimize workflows, plugins, Power Automate flows, and custom applications.
  • ⁠ ⁠Integrate Dynamics 365 CRM with other enterprise systems, ERP, and third-party applications.
  • ⁠ ⁠Work closely with stakeholders to gather business requirements and translate them into technical solutions.
  • ⁠ ⁠Perform data migration, system upgrades, and performance optimization.
  • ⁠ ⁠Ensure CRM solutions are compliant with security, data governance, and regulatory requirements.
  • ⁠ ⁠Troubleshoot and resolve CRM-related technical issues and provide support for end-users.
  • ⁠ ⁠Stay updated on Microsoft Dynamics 365 and Power Platform advancements.
  • ⁠ ⁠Provide guidance and mentorship to junior team members.

Requirements

Qualifications & Skills

  • ⁠ ⁠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field.
  • ⁠ ⁠5+ years of hands-on experience with Microsoft Dynamics 365 CRM (Customer Engagement).
  • ⁠ ⁠Strong proficiency in Power Platform, Power Automate, Power Apps, and Dataverse.
  • ⁠ ⁠Expertise in customizing forms, entities, business rules, workflows, and security roles.
  • ⁠ ⁠Proficiency in C#, JavaScript, .NET, and SQL Server.
  • ⁠ ⁠Experience with REST/SOAP APIs and integrating Dynamics 365 with other enterprise systems.
  • ⁠ ⁠Knowledge of Azure services (Logic Apps, Functions, DevOps) is a plus.
  • ⁠ ⁠Familiarity with Agile (Scrum, SAFe) methodologies.
  • ⁠ ⁠Excellent problem-solving and communication skills.
  • ⁠ ⁠Microsoft certifications in Dynamics 365 CRM or Power Platform are highly preferred.
